Patrick Buckley b0ed67aa60 refactor(skills): move applied-skill body out of the identity system message
Step 3 of the skill/persona split: an applied skill (including default skills)
is CAPABILITY context, so its body no longer sits in the identity system
message. It rides its own message (user role) after the identity block, with a
short intro naming the active skill. The <available-skills> discovery catalog
stays in the system message.

Two consequences:
- The cached identity prefix (persona BASE + ENV + POLICIES + catalogs) stays
  stable across skills(load): loading/clearing a skill changes only the
  trailing capability message, not the identity block.
- The task_agent base (_agent_system_messages) is snapshotted BEFORE the skill
  block, so a parent's applied skill no longer leaks into the sub-agent prefix
  (the sub-agent supplies its own persona identity and skill via _exec_task).

PRE-MERGE GATE: the design gates this on a model-adherence eval (this branch vs
main) verifying the model follows a skill as well from a context message as it
did from the system message (design section 7 Q1; ASSUMED-neutral, UNVERIFIED).
That eval is not runnable in-tree and MUST clear before this branch merges.
Mechanical structure is pinned by TestSkillContextPlacement.

Deferred follow-up: sub-agent (task_agent) skill-resource materialization, so
${TURNSTONE_SKILL_DIR} stays literal on that path (unchanged since step 1).

Test helpers (_sys_content) now read the full prompt prefix (identity + skill
context) so placement-agnostic assertions keep working.

# 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# _render_template unit tests
# 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
class TestRenderTemplate:
def test_basic_substitution(self):
result = _render_template("Hello {{name}}", {"name": "world"})
assert result == "Hello world"
def test_multiple_variables(self):
result = _render_template(
"Model: {{model}}, WS: {{ws_id}}", {"model": "gpt-5", "ws_id": "abc123"}
)
assert result == "Model: gpt-5, WS: abc123"
def test_unresolvable_variable_kept(self):
result = _render_template("Hello {{unknown}}", {"model": "gpt-5"})
assert result == "Hello {{unknown}}"
def test_empty_context(self):
result = _render_template("No vars here", {})
assert result == "No vars here"
def test_duplicate_placeholder(self):
result = _render_template("{{x}} and {{x}}", {"x": "val"})
assert result == "val and val"
def test_no_cross_variable_injection(self):
# If model contains {{ws_id}}, it must NOT be expanded
result = _render_template("Model: {{model}}", {"model": "{{ws_id}}", "ws_id": "secret"})
assert result == "Model: {{ws_id}}"
assert "secret" not in result
